JavaScript Formatter: Consistente codestijl voor betere ontwikkeling
Leer waarom JavaScript-formattering belangrijk is voor code reviews. Tabs vs spaties, puntkomma's, ESLint, Prettier en onze gratis online tool.
3 februari 2026
Waarom JavaScript formatteren?
JavaScript is een van de meest gebruikte programmeertalen ter wereld en drijft alles aan, van eenvoudige webinteracties tot complexe server-side applicaties. Met zijn flexibele syntaxis en meerdere manieren om hetzelfde resultaat te bereiken, kunnen JavaScript-codebases snel inconsistent worden zonder goede formatteringsstandaarden.
Inconsistente formattering in JavaScript creert echte problemen. Wanneer ontwikkelaars in hetzelfde team verschillende stijlen gebruiken, worden code reviews rommelig met formatteringswijzigingen vermengd met logicawijzigingen.
Het tabs vs spaties debat
Een van de oudste debatten in programmeren is of je tabs of spaties moet gebruiken voor inspringing. Tabs bieden flexibiliteit omdat elke ontwikkelaar zijn editor kan configureren om tabs op zijn voorkeursbreedte weer te geven. Spaties zorgen ervoor dat code er overal identiek uitziet.
De meeste moderne JavaScript-stijlgidsen, waaronder die van Airbnb en Google, bevelen twee spaties aan voor inspringing. De JavaScript-gemeenschap heeft zich grotendeels op deze conventie gestandaardiseerd.
Puntkomma's: wel of niet gebruiken
JavaScript's automatische puntkomma-invoeging maakt het mogelijk dat code in de meeste gevallen zonder expliciete puntkomma's draait. Dit heeft geleid tot twee kampen: zij die altijd puntkomma's gebruiken voor duidelijkheid, en zij die ze weglaten voor schonere code.
Een formatter elimineert dit debat volledig door automatisch puntkomma's toe te voegen of te verwijderen op basis van je configuratie.
ESLint en Prettier standaarden
Het JavaScript-ecosysteem biedt twee krachtige tools voor codekwaliteit: ESLint en Prettier.
- ESLint is voornamelijk een linter die potentiele fouten detecteert en coderingspatronen afdwingt.
- Prettier is een eigenzinnige code-formatter die alle formatteringsbeslissingen afhandelt.
Veel teams gebruiken beide tools samen: Prettier voor formattering en ESLint voor codekwaliteit.
Hoe onze online JavaScript-formatter werkt
Onze JavaScript-formatter gebruikt industriestandaard formatteringsregels om je code direct te transformeren. Plak je JavaScript in het invoerveld en de tool past consistente inspringing, juiste spatiering rondom operatoren, schone regelovergangen en standaard haakjesplaatsing toe.
De formatter behoudt de logica en het gedrag van je code terwijl de visuele presentatie wordt verbeterd.
Voordelen voor code reviews
Wanneer je team een consistente formatter gebruikt, worden code reviews dramatisch productiever. Reviewers kunnen zich volledig richten op logica, architectuur en potentiele problemen.
Onboarding van nieuwe ontwikkelaars
Een consistent geformateerde codebase is gastvrij voor nieuwe ontwikkelaars.
Veelvoorkomende formatteringsconventies
- Accolades: Openingsaccolades op dezelfde regel als het statement, sluitingsaccolades op hun eigen regel
- Spatiering: Spaties rondom operatoren, na komma's en binnen objectliteralen
- Regellengte: Maximaal 80 tot 100 tekens per regel
- Trailing komma's: Na het laatste item in meerdere regels arrays en objecten
Gebruik onze gratis online JavaScript-formatter om je code direct op te schonen.